"Kurt, I found- no!"
Blaine's heart dropped. His eyes instantly pooled with tears. The gun he'd found at the local convenient store minutes before clattered to the ground.
Standing before him, with his arms braced against the bathroom sink, was Kurt. His body trembled. There was a gash in his side, spilling its last few drops of blood before it fully decayed and turned an ugly, crimson color. Slowly, Kurt watched in the mirror as his face deteriorated, turning a sickly shade of green, peeling, rotting away.
Blaine choked back a sob.
"B-Blaine," Kurt's raspy, hoarse voice spoke. It echoed off of the red and white tiled walls. "R-run... go... please."
"How? You- you were safe..."
"Karofsky," Kurt hissed. "Bl-Blaine... go."
There were tears streaming down his face. "I can't leave you, Kurt," he whispered. "I can't."
"T-then shoot-" Kurt cried out, gripping the sink tighter as his body spasmed. "Please..."
He convulsed again and this time fell to the ground with a demonic howl. Instinctively, Blaine ran to his side, scooping up what was left of his boyfriend in his arms. He watched as Kurt's once blue-grey irises turned black. Kurt was gone.
He didn't have time to run. He didn't want to.
"As long as we're together," he whispered, just before Kurt attacked.
